Understanding Air Duct Cleaning in Salt Lake City

What is Air Duct Cleaning?

Air duct cleaning is a vital maintenance service designed to remove dust, dirt, allergens, and other contaminants from the ductwork of HVAC systems. Over time, these systems accumulate organic debris, including mold spores, pet dander, pollen, and dust mites, which can hinder efficiency and negatively impact indoor air quality. This preventive measure enhances not only the cleanliness of your home environment but also the longevity and effectiveness of your HVAC system.

Signs Your Home Needs Air Duct Cleaning

Indicators of Dirty Ducts

Recognizing the need for air duct cleaning can be straightforward if you know what signs to watch for:

  • Visible Dust: If you notice dust accumulating around vents or on furniture quickly after cleaning, it may be time to schedule a cleaning.
  • Increased Allergy Symptoms: Persistent allergy symptoms among household members can indicate the presence of dust, mold, or other allergens in your duct system.
  • Unpleasant Odors: A musty smell or other unpleasant odors from your vents can signal the presence of mold or debris.
  • Pest Infestations: Signs of rodents or insects can indicate that pests are navigating your ductwork.

When to Schedule a Cleaning

Experts recommend having your air ducts cleaned every 3 to 5 years, depending on several factors such as:

  • The presence of pets, which can contribute fur and dander.
  • Recent renovations that can stir up dust.
  • Homeowners with allergies or respiratory conditions may benefit from more frequent cleanings.

Enhancing HVAC Efficiency

Dirty ducts can obstruct airflow, causing your HVAC system to work harder and leading to increased energy costs. A cleaner system allows air to flow freely, which can help lower energy bills by 5-15%. Moreover, regular maintenance can extend the lifespan of your HVAC system, saving homeowners from costly replacements.

Choosing the Right Air Duct Cleaning Service in Salt Lake City

What to Look for in a Service Provider

Choosing the right service provider is crucial for effective air duct cleaning. Look for companies with the following attributes:

  • Experience: A well-established company with a proven track record is essential. Experienced technicians will likely offer the best service.
  • Certification: Certification from reputable organizations, such as the National Air Duct Cleaners Association (NADCA), demonstrates adherence to industry standards.
  • Insurance: Ensure the company is properly insured, which protects you in case of damage during the cleaning process.

Questions to Ask Before Hiring

Clarifying key points can help ensure you hire the right contractor:

  • How long have you been in business?
  • Can you provide references from previous clients?
  • What cleaning processes and equipment do you use?
  • Do you perform any inspections prior to cleaning, and what do they entail?
  • What guarantee do you offer for your services?

What to Expect During the Cleaning Process

Understanding what to expect during the cleaning process can help ease any worries:

  • Initial Assessment: Technicians will inspect your HVAC system to determine the level of cleaning needed.
  • Using Specialized Equipment: They will use high-powered vacuums and brushes designed specifically for duct cleaning to remove debris.
  • Post-Cleaning Inspection: After cleaning, the technician should perform a final assessment to ensure the area is thoroughly cleaned and that no debris remains.

Post-Cleaning Maintenance Tips

To maintain your air ducts after a professional cleaning, consider the following tips:

  • Change your HVAC filters regularly—typically every 1 to 3 months.
  • Schedule regular inspections of your HVAC system to catch problems early.
  • Consider using an air purifier to help minimize dust and allergens in your home.
